[kwin] [Bug 398973] The window decorations configuration pop-up needs a Defaults icon
https://bugs.kde.org/show_bug.cgi?id=398973 --- Comment #14 from Patrick Silva --- I can confirm that this bug is fixed on Plasma 5.18 beta + Qt 5.14. :) Thank you all. Operating System: Arch Linux KDE Plasma Version: 5.17.90 KDE Frameworks Version: 5.66.0 Qt Version: 5.14.0 -- You are receiving this mail because: You are watching all bug changes.
[kwin] [Bug 398973] The window decorations configuration pop-up needs a Defaults icon
https://bugs.kde.org/show_bug.cgi?id=398973 Björn Feber changed: What|Removed |Added Status|CONFIRMED |RESOLVED Latest Commit||https://commits.kde.org/fra ||meworkintegration/50593c561 ||8998535cc9f482aa25565c5aeb3 ||68ce Resolution|--- |FIXED --- Comment #13 from Björn Feber --- Git commit 50593c5618998535cc9f482aa25565c5aeb368ce by Björn Feber. Committed on 08/10/2019 at 14:19. Pushed by bfeber into branch 'master'. Add standard icons to support to all entries in QDialogButtonBox Summary: Implement the new enumarations introduced in Qt 5.14: https://codereview.qt-project.org/c/qt/qtbase/+/254494/ Test Plan: Can't really test since Qt 5.14 is not released yet, but QDialogButtonBox buttons should now all have icons. Reviewers: #frameworks, #vdg, davidedmundson, ngraham Reviewed By: #vdg, davidedmundson, ngraham Subscribers: ndavis, dhaumann, davidedmundson, #vdg, kde-frameworks-devel, #frameworks Tags: #frameworks Differential Revision: https://phabricator.kde.org/D24415 M +17 -1src/kstyle/kstyle.cpp https://commits.kde.org/frameworkintegration/50593c5618998535cc9f482aa25565c5aeb368ce -- You are receiving this mail because: You are watching all bug changes.
[kwin] [Bug 398973] The window decorations configuration pop-up needs a Defaults icon
https://bugs.kde.org/show_bug.cgi?id=398973 --- Comment #12 from Björn Feber --- (In reply to Björn Feber from comment #11) > I can make a patch that sets it for Qt 5.14 or higher though if you want. Here it is: https://phabricator.kde.org/D24415 -- You are receiving this mail because: You are watching all bug changes.
[kwin] [Bug 398973] The window decorations configuration pop-up needs a Defaults icon
https://bugs.kde.org/show_bug.cgi?id=398973 --- Comment #11 from Björn Feber --- (In reply to Björn Feber from comment #10) > Looks like the enum is only in Qt 5.14: > https://github.com/qt/qtbase/blob/9a9bdebb92eda34939c8a7442f06d24ded82b799/ > src/widgets/styles/qstyle.cpp#L2116 I can make a patch that sets it for Qt 5.14 or higher though if you want. -- You are receiving this mail because: You are watching all bug changes.
[kwin] [Bug 398973] The window decorations configuration pop-up needs a Defaults icon
https://bugs.kde.org/show_bug.cgi?id=398973 --- Comment #10 from Björn Feber --- Looks like the enum is only in Qt 5.14: https://github.com/qt/qtbase/blob/9a9bdebb92eda34939c8a7442f06d24ded82b799/src/widgets/styles/qstyle.cpp#L2116 -- You are receiving this mail because: You are watching all bug changes.
[kwin] [Bug 398973] The window decorations configuration pop-up needs a Defaults icon
https://bugs.kde.org/show_bug.cgi?id=398973 --- Comment #9 from David Edmundson --- >Is your patch included in Qt 5.13 beta2 David? Yes, but we need the matching breeze side to set the icon. That's not merged as it's hard to merge a frameworks patch against non-released code in case it changes later. -- You are receiving this mail because: You are watching all bug changes.
[kwin] [Bug 398973] The window decorations configuration pop-up needs a Defaults icon
https://bugs.kde.org/show_bug.cgi?id=398973 --- Comment #8 from Björn Feber --- Made a patch: https://phabricator.kde.org/D20709 -- You are receiving this mail because: You are watching all bug changes.
[kwin] [Bug 398973] The window decorations configuration pop-up needs a Defaults icon
https://bugs.kde.org/show_bug.cgi?id=398973 --- Comment #7 from Patrick Silva --- Is your patch included in Qt 5.13 beta2 David? This bug persists here. Operating System: Arch Linux KDE Plasma Version: 5.15.4 KDE Frameworks Version: 5.57.0 Qt Version: 5.13.0 beta2 -- You are receiving this mail because: You are watching all bug changes.
[kwin] [Bug 398973] The window decorations configuration pop-up needs a Defaults icon
https://bugs.kde.org/show_bug.cgi?id=398973 Björn Feber changed: What|Removed |Added CC||febe...@gmail.com --- Comment #6 from Björn Feber --- Should we still do the workaround or just close this? -- You are receiving this mail because: You are watching all bug changes.
[kwin] [Bug 398973] The window decorations configuration pop-up needs a Defaults icon
https://bugs.kde.org/show_bug.cgi?id=398973 --- Comment #5 from David Edmundson --- I forgot to push my patch: https://codereview.qt-project.org/254494 -- You are receiving this mail because: You are watching all bug changes.
[kwin] [Bug 398973] The window decorations configuration pop-up needs a Defaults icon
https://bugs.kde.org/show_bug.cgi?id=398973 --- Comment #4 from David Edmundson --- *** Bug 404813 has been marked as a duplicate of this bug. *** -- You are receiving this mail because: You are watching all bug changes.
[kwin] [Bug 398973] The window decorations configuration pop-up needs a Defaults icon
https://bugs.kde.org/show_bug.cgi?id=398973 Patrick Silva changed: What|Removed |Added CC||bugsefor...@gmx.com -- You are receiving this mail because: You are watching all bug changes.
[kwin] [Bug 398973] The window decorations configuration pop-up needs a Defaults icon
https://bugs.kde.org/show_bug.cgi?id=398973 David Edmundson changed: What|Removed |Added Keywords||junior-jobs --- Comment #3 from David Edmundson --- I'll fix properly in Qt. In the meantime, it can be a nice junior job for someone's first patch. kcmwin/kwindecoration/declarative-plugin/previewbridge.cpp ~line 213 get the restore defaults button, set an icon explicitly. Ideally using KStandardGuiItem to get the icon name. -- You are receiving this mail because: You are watching all bug changes.
[kwin] [Bug 398973] The window decorations configuration pop-up needs a Defaults icon
https://bugs.kde.org/show_bug.cgi?id=398973 David Edmundson changed: What|Removed |Added Status|REPORTED|CONFIRMED Ever confirmed|0 |1 CC||k...@davidedmundson.co.uk --- Comment #2 from David Edmundson --- Confirmed. It uses QDialogButtonBox correctly, yet the icon for defaults isn't being applied there. Even inside QtDesigner. QDialogButtonBox doesn't set icons for: case QDialogButtonBox::YesToAll: case QDialogButtonBox::NoToAll: case QDialogButtonBox::SaveAll: case QDialogButtonBox::Abort: case QDialogButtonBox::Retry: case QDialogButtonBox::Ignore: case QDialogButtonBox::RestoreDefaults: Doing so means changing QDialogButtonBox then QStyle to add an SP_DialogDefaults enum and then changing kstyle :/ (or I do a shoddy lazy kwin oneliner) -- You are receiving this mail because: You are watching all bug changes.
[kwin] [Bug 398973] The window decorations configuration pop-up needs a Defaults icon
https://bugs.kde.org/show_bug.cgi?id=398973 --- Comment #1 from Andrew Crouthamel --- Another note. The defaults icon currently used in the main window is not the same one used elsewhere. May be best to standardize on the other one. -- You are receiving this mail because: You are watching all bug changes.
[kwin] [Bug 398973] The window decorations configuration pop-up needs a Defaults icon
https://bugs.kde.org/show_bug.cgi?id=398973 Nate Graham changed: What|Removed |Added Product|systemsettings |kwin Component|general |general CC||n...@kde.org Assignee|plasma-b...@kde.org |kwin-bugs-n...@kde.org -- You are receiving this mail because: You are watching all bug changes.